NTP install and configure in Centos & RHEL
$ sudo yum install -y ntp
$ sudo systemctl start ntpd
$ sudo systemctl enable ntpd
$ sudo systemctl status ntpd
$ sudo systemctl stop ntpd
$ sudo ntpd -gq
$ sudo systemctl start ntpd
NTP install and configure in Ubuntu
$ sudo ufw allow out 123/udp
$ sudo ufw allow 123/udp
$ sudo apt-get update
$ sudo apt-get install ntp
$ sudo systemctl status ntp
$ sudo ntpdate pool.ntp.org
$ ntpq -p
